Abstract

A house-type warehouse group comprises a group of steel silos (1). An outer steel silo (1) is provided with a side wall connection member (3). A heat insulation all (4) surrounding the steel silos (1) is fixed to the side wall connection member (3) to form an attachment structure of the steel silo. An upper heat insulation cover (5) is arranged on an upper portion of the heat insulation wall (4), and is supported via an upper cover connection member (6) and a frame (7) above the steel silo (1). Also provided is a construction method of a house-type warehouse group, comprising: firstly, constructing single steel silos (1) to form a silo group; then installing, on the steel silo (1), a side wall connection member (3), an upper cover connection member (6) and a frame (7); and lastly, securing, on the steel silo (1), and using a side wall connection member (3), a heat insulation wall (4), and securing, on the steel silo (1), and using the upper cover connection member (6) and the frame, an upper heat insulation cover (5). The house-type warehouse group employs exterior insulation, and therefore the steel silo itself needs no insulation, reducing construction costs, reducing construction duration, providing temperature control in the warehouse, and facilitating food insulation.

背景技术Background technique
传统储粮仓都是在每个筒仓的外表面单独做保温,对于小直径筒仓群单独做保温费用较高,同时由于筒仓外侧具有保温层,维修较麻烦,保温不以调控。如果简单的在筒仓的外侧建造一个大型建筑物把粮仓统统包在其中,成本很高。The traditional grain storage bins are separately insulated on the outer surface of each silo. For the small diameter silo group, the insulation cost is higher. At the same time, because the outer side of the silo has an insulation layer, the maintenance is troublesome and the heat preservation is not regulated. If you simply build a large building on the outside of the silo and pack the granary in it, the cost is high.

有益效果:Beneficial effects:
1、本发明在钢板筒仓集群的外侧保温,施工速度快,造价低,粮仓放在类似库房内使用,防风雨,使用寿命长。输送设备在库房内使用,可免去防风雨结构要求,维修方便,容易操作。库房内可以随时调节温度,保证粮食始终处于低温状态,使粮食保鲜。筒仓本身则不必再保温,通过筒仓集群的总体外围保温,不但大幅度的减少了保温面积,降低施工成本,还显著缩短了建造周期,也不必建造砖石结构等传统保温外墙的建筑基础。人员在搭建好的类似薄壳的仿室内环境工作,更加舒适,且无论刮风下雨都可正常工作。1. The invention is insulated on the outer side of the steel silo cluster, the construction speed is fast, the construction cost is low, and the granary is used in a similar warehouse, which is weatherproof and has a long service life. The conveying equipment is used in the warehouse, which can avoid the requirements of weatherproof structure, convenient maintenance and easy operation. The temperature can be adjusted at any time in the warehouse to ensure that the food is always in a low temperature state, so that the food is kept fresh. The silo itself does not need to be insulated, and the overall external insulation of the silo cluster not only greatly reduces the heat preservation area, reduces the construction cost, but also significantly shortens the construction period, and does not need to build a traditional thermal insulation exterior wall structure such as masonry structure. basis. The personnel work in a simple indoor environment like a thin shell, which is more comfortable and works well regardless of wind and rain.
2、筒仓为圆形筒仓较方形筒仓受力合理,造价低。筒仓仓顶为平顶,施工简便,同时平顶上可以安装输送设备,免去了传统的尖顶粮仓设备栈桥搭建,造价低,操作安全。2. The silo is a round silo with a relatively square force and a low cost. The silo roof is flat, the construction is simple, and the conveying equipment can be installed on the flat top, which eliminates the traditional apex granary equipment trestle construction, low cost and safe operation.
3、本发明保温墙体直接固定在筒仓上,因为保温墙体与传统的砖石结构墙体或者钢结构墙体相比,非常轻薄,形成的壳体结构中可以完成传统的砖石结构墙体或者钢结构墙体的所有功能,但是由于其轻薄刚性差,难以自成刚性房屋,更不能支撑上盖重量,本发明采用外壳附着在筒仓上的刚性互补结构,提供了低成本高性能跨界解决方案,采用保温薄壳墙体与筒仓刚性结合的附着结构,造价低、施工速度快,性能优越。由于不需要采用传统的砖石结构,减少了砖及水泥制作过程的污染排放,提高环保效果,减小占地面积,易于维护。3. The thermal insulation wall of the invention is directly fixed on the silo, because the thermal insulation wall is very light and thin compared with the traditional masonry structural wall or the steel structural wall, and the formed masonry structure can be completed in the formed shell structure. All the functions of the wall or steel structure wall, but due to its light and thin rigidity, it is difficult to form a rigid house, and it is not able to support the weight of the upper cover. The present invention adopts a rigid complementary structure in which the outer casing is attached to the silo, providing low cost and high cost. The performance cross-border solution adopts the attachment structure of the rigid thin-walled wall and the silo rigidly combined, which has low cost, high construction speed and superior performance. Since the traditional masonry structure is not required, the pollution discharge of the brick and cement production process is reduced, the environmental protection effect is improved, the floor space is reduced, and the maintenance is easy.
